在聚合SQL语句中插入WHERE条件是为了对聚合结果进行筛选,只返回满足特定条件的数据。WHERE条件可以用于过滤聚合结果,使得结果更加精确和有针对性。
聚合SQL语句通常使用GROUP BY子句对数据进行分组,并使用聚合函数(如SUM、COUNT、AVG等)对每个组进行计算。在这种情况下,WHERE条件可以在聚合之前对数据进行筛选。
以下是一个示例的聚合SQL语句,其中插入了WHERE条件:
SELECT column1, aggregate_function(column2)
FROM table
WHERE condition
GROUP BY column1
在上述语句中,column1是用于分组的列,aggregate_function是聚合函数,table是要查询的表,condition是WHERE条件。
插入WHERE条件的优势包括:
- 数据筛选:WHERE条件可以根据特定的条件过滤数据,只返回满足条件的结果,提高查询的准确性和效率。
- 数据精确性:通过WHERE条件,可以对聚合结果进行更精确的筛选,得到符合特定条件的数据。
- 灵活性:WHERE条件可以根据需求进行灵活调整,满足不同的查询需求。
应用场景:
- 在销售数据分析中,可以使用聚合SQL语句计算每个销售人员的销售总额,并通过插入WHERE条件筛选出销售总额超过一定数值的销售人员。
- 在用户行为分析中,可以使用聚合SQL语句计算每个用户的访问次数,并通过插入WHERE条件筛选出访问次数超过一定阈值的用户。
腾讯云相关产品和产品介绍链接地址:
- 腾讯云数据库 TencentDB:https://cloud.tencent.com/product/tencentdb
- 腾讯云云服务器 CVM:https://cloud.tencent.com/product/cvm
- 腾讯云云原生容器服务 TKE:https://cloud.tencent.com/product/tke
- 腾讯云人工智能 AI:https://cloud.tencent.com/product/ai
- 腾讯云物联网 IOT:https://cloud.tencent.com/product/iot
- 腾讯云移动开发 MSDK:https://cloud.tencent.com/product/msdk
- 腾讯云对象存储 COS:https://cloud.tencent.com/product/cos
- 腾讯云区块链 TBaaS:https://cloud.tencent.com/product/tbaas
- 腾讯云元宇宙 Tencent XR:https://cloud.tencent.com/product/xr
请注意,以上链接仅供参考,具体产品选择应根据实际需求进行评估和决策。